Our Investment DB Business Unit acts as a key component of our consulting services and helps firmly establish us as a UK market leader in this area. We currently advise on over £200 billion of assets for our diverse client base, which includes DB pension trustees and sponsors across a wide variety of business and industry sectors, local government pension schemes (LGPS) and other public sector clients.

We have an exciting opportunity to join this Business Unit as an Investment Consultant to focus on supporting our LGPS clients.


What will your role look like?
In this role you will be a key member of the Investment DB Business Unit. Day to day your role will involve conducting high quality research analysis and communicating investment advice from this to a wide range of clients, predominately focusing on our LGPS clients.

You’ll review and sign off investment advice on a wide range of topics including investment strategy, structure, investment markets, risk management, asset managers, responsible investment and governance.

Though this is a varied role, your key tasks will include:

  • Directing and advising a portfolio of predominantly LGPS clients on a range of investment matters
  • Delivering high quality, expert investment advice by employing strategic and innovative solutions
  • Being actively involvement in developing business for the firm, through client ‘prospecting’, relationship building and supporting new business pitches; working with other areas of the firm to facilitate ‘cross-selling’
  • Undertaking activities to build and enhance your Business Unit and firm’s profile – including networking and speaking at relevant conferences
  • Developing the consulting capabilities of the practice by coaching and mentoring junior team members including investment analysts within our client teams
  • Contributing to internal initiatives, such as Quality Assurance and Learning and Development programmes
